Porcelain Silkies are a fun color! They are a project color, so there will be color variation. The “perfect” color is a light lavender all over with a light buff across wings/back/chest. Some of these chicks come out more heavy on buff. They are so cute and fluffy! Check out our breeding pen of porcelain silkies for more information on the color and breed.
